logo

Output 888c3e31177863b001cfe959a68381f52976fa28efe66884da1bd7595682c0af:1

value
184678965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5395164be635a25d64edb626fc63d5c506d508 OP_EQUAL
address
3Cw7AYVrKPURfhokGZmJ21Vxf4XSVLtAvt
transaction
888c3e31177863b001cfe959a68381f52976fa28efe66884da1bd7595682c0af